About this experience

This is a Private Land Excursion by mini van accompanied by a Proffesional Certified Guide and a driver to know Krabi province.

Located in the lush Jungle, this tour is ideal to discover the wild land of Krabi region!

Kayak ride through the mangrove area of the beautiful Ao Thalane, swim in natural pools under the limestone cliffs and discover places to photograph spectacular panoramas, visit Tha Pom Klong Song Nam: National Park belonging to Krabi province, where the seawater meets the fresh water.

Also visit an authentic and surprising Temple built amidst a limestone cliff. And Sa Kaeo! It seems just a small shallow lagoon with a surprising blue color, but you can never touch the bottom due to its 200 meters depth and it is considered the deepest land pool in ALL OF ASIA!

We will also enjoy an exquisite local Lunch on a Restaurant with views to the Hong Islands...

About Krabi

Krabi is a stunning province on Thailand's Andaman Coast, renowned for its dramatic limestone karst formations, turquoise waters, and lush jungles. It offers a mix of adventure, relaxation, and cultural experiences, making it a top destination for travelers seeking both natural beauty and vibrant local culture.

Top Attractions

Railay Beach

Railay Beach is a stunning stretch of sand accessible only by boat. It's known for its dramatic limestone cliffs, turquoise waters, and excellent rock climbing opportunities.

Beach Full day Free (activities may have separate costs)

Tiger Cave Temple (Wat Tham Suea)

This temple is famous for its 1,237 steps leading to a stunning viewpoint. The temple itself is a significant Buddhist site with a rich history.

Religious/Adventure 2-3 hours Free (donations appreciated)

Emerald Pool (Sa Morakot)

A natural jade-green pool surrounded by lush jungle. It's a popular spot for swimming and relaxing in the cool waters.

Nature Half day 100 THB entrance fee

Best Time to Visit

November to February

This is the coolest and driest time of the year, perfect for outdoor activities and beach relaxation. The weather is pleasant, and the skies are clear.

24-32°C 75-90°F
